Output de11b7c920f1a0f38d5fe5f232650c65ca365620704ef42f3bf58d8649106b0a:50

value
66531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30c989f6e2bbb30fdcc66bbe38765639546e840 OP_EQUAL
address
3LvwbDbukLJXg1cF38swzAUByc99Rp2j9e
transaction
de11b7c920f1a0f38d5fe5f232650c65ca365620704ef42f3bf58d8649106b0a
spent
true